Documentation

It is crucial to collect all documentation about the accident as quickly as you can. This will help your lawyer determine the strength and potential of your case. They can then map out a plan to win your lawsuit.

While you wait for police to arrive, jot down the names and contact numbers of all the parties involved. Be sure to collect the insurance information of every driver, along with the description of the vehicle.

It is essential to get all the details as quickly after the accident as possible. This will avoid any future disputes. It is also important to take photographs of the accident scene, as well as the vehicles. These photos will help your lawyer understand what happened, and also help you build strong arguments for the other driver.

Additionally, you should keep all receipts for medical treatments and any other expenses which were incurred as a result of to the incident. The receipts will also aid your lawyer in determining the amount of damage you've sustained and how much compensation you are entitled to you.

Witness Statements

The witness statements are an essential part of any auto los angeles automobile accident attorneys claim. They can assist your lawyer construct an impressive case and help you get a fair settlement.

A witness statement is a formal written report of what a person observed during or shortly after an accident. A statement should contain precise details of the crash and who was involved and also any injuries or property damage.

It is very important to obtain witness statements as soon after the incident to ensure the statements are as complete and precise as possible. This is especially important in the event that you took photos of the accident.

There are many ways to get witnesses' statements after an charlotte auto accident attorneys accident. This includes talking to people who were around during the time of the accident, obtaining the contact details of these witnesses, and requesting witnesses to make a statement about what they observed.

Eyewitnesses who were driving or walking around the scene of the collision are typically competent witnesses because they had a clear view of what happened and are less likely to be biased towards one side of the argument. They can also be a fantastic source of information about the behavior of the other driver, which may help you to prove that they were not responsible for the crash.

Customers and employees from nearby businesses can often provide great witness testimony as they are able to observe what happened inside the building. They may have video footage of the security cameras in the store.

In any auto accident it is vital to identify the best witnesses. It can be difficult to ask someone to make a statement, so it is recommended to approach them gently and politely.

Make sure you obtain the witness' full name, address, and any other information relevant to your case. Once you have obtained the documents, request them to sign and date them. They should be kept in a safe location for future reference. This will make it easier to verify claims in the future.
